Chapter 17-81. POLYSOMNOGRAPHY |
Section 17-8105. RENEWALS, REINSTATEMENTS, AND REACTIVATIONS OF POLYSOMNOGRAPHIC TECHNOLOGIST LICENSES
-
8105.1An applicant for renewal of a polysomnographic technologist license shall:
(a) Complete a minimum of twenty (20) continuing education credits
during the two (2) year period preceding the date the license expires;
(b) Attest to completion of the required continuing education credits on the
renewal application form; and
(c) Be subject to a random audit.
8105.2To qualify to reactivate a polysomnographic technologist license, a person in inactive status within the meaning of § 511 of the Act, D.C. Official Code § 3-1205.11 (2001) shall:
(a) Submit an application to reactivate the license;
(b) Submit proof pursuant to § 8105.7 of having completed twenty (20) hours of approved continuing education credits within the two (2) year period preceding the date of the application for reactivation of that applicant’s license and an additional ten (10) hours of approved continuing education credit for each additional year that the applicant was in inactive status beginning with the third year;
(c) Pay the required reactivation fee; and
(d) Submit a completed criminal background check in accordance with 17 DCMR § 8501.
8105.3To qualify for reinstatement of a license, an applicant for reinstatement shall:
(a) Submit an application to reinstate the license;
(b) Submit proof pursuant to § 8105.7 of having completed twenty (20) hours of approved continuing education credits within the two (2) year period preceding the date of the application for reinstatement of that applicant’s license and an additional ten (10) hours of approved continuing education credit for each additional year that the applicant was in an inactive status beginning with the third year;
(c) Pay the required reinstatement fee; and
(d) Submit a completed criminal background check in accordance with 17 DCMR § 8501.
